Mrs. Pauline Higgins Darnell, 85, died September 25, 2008 at her residence in King.
Daughter of the late John Aaron and Treva Peoples Higgins, she was born in Forsyth County on August 8, 1923.
Mrs. Darnell was retired from the N. C. Baptist Hospital.
She was preceded in death by a son, John Aaron Darnell and her husband, Albert Richard Darnell.
Surviving are two daughters: Judy D. Speas and husband, Junior, and Mardi D. White, all of King; four grandchildren: Gerri S. Vaden and husband, Jimmy, of Germanton, Jolena S. Arrington and husband, Mike, of King, Melanie and Benjamin White, also of King; and two great-grandchildren: Cody Newsome and Johnny Arrington. In addition, she is survived by a sister, Geraldine Templeton of Germanton, and several very special nieces and nephews.
